A solid, well constructed GRP Golden Hind 31 from 1981. A very versatile, sloop rigged, triple keeler which is ideal for shallower waters, having only a 1.2m draft, yet these boats have gained an enviable reputation for long distance, blue water cruising. In fact, many of these boats have circumnavigated and in the late 70s/ 80s had completed more transatlantic crossing than any other production boat.
